Thick security film holds glass intact under repeated impact โ dramatically slowing smash-and-grab entry attempts and burglaries.
On impact, fragments bond to the film rather than spraying inward. Critical for earthquake zones, storm events, and accident liability.
Government-spec films tested to GSA/ANSI standards reduce flying glass debris in explosion events โ used in federal and municipal facilities.
Most security films block 99% of UV and provide measurable solar heat rejection โ functional security with thermal performance.

Security film does not make glass unbreakable, but it holds shattered glass fragments together on impact โ significantly slowing forced entry and reducing injury risk from glass shards. Thicker films (12โ14 mil) provide the highest resistance.
Safety film (4โ8 mil) is designed to hold glass together after breakage, reducing injury risk. Security film (8โ14 mil) adds forced-entry resistance โ it slows an intruder significantly beyond just holding glass. For burglary deterrence, 8 mil minimum is recommended.
Yes. Security film is a retrofit solution applied directly to existing glass โ no window replacement required. Installation is complete in hours with no structural changes.

Yes. Dual-performance films combine safety or security grade thickness with solar heat rejection and UV blocking. This is one of the most common specifications in Arizona โ the heat load requires solar control, and the security requirement is addressed simultaneously.
